vivante-health / monolog-stackdriver-handler
Stackdriver Handler based on Monolog StreamHandler
Installs: 12 946
Dependents: 0
Suggesters: 0
Security: 0
Stars: 3
Watchers: 4
Forks: 1
pkg:composer/vivante-health/monolog-stackdriver-handler
Requires
- php: ^7.0
- monolog/monolog: ^1.23
Requires (Dev)
This package is auto-updated.
Last update: 2025-11-15 23:44:18 UTC
README
Monolog Handler Structured Logging [https://cloud.google.com/logging/docs/structured-logging]
This handler is GCP_PROJECT ID agnostic.
Extends Monolog\Handler\StreamHandler setting the formatter to JsonFormatter and adding severity field, while eliminating unused information.
Installation
composer require vivante-health/monolog-stackdriver-handler
Basic Usage
<?php use VivanteHealth\MonologStackdriverHandler\StackdriverHandler; $log = new Logger('name'); $log->pushHandler( new StackdriverHandler() );
License
vivante-health/monolog-stackdriver-handler is licensed under the MIT License - see the LICENSE file for details